Ogygianadj.1

Brit. /əʊˈdʒɪdʒɪən/, U.S. /oʊˈdʒɪdʒiən/
Forms: 1500s–1600s Ogigian, 1600s 1800s– Ogygian.
Origin: A borrowing from Latin, combined with an English element. Etymons: Latin Ōgygius , -an suffix.
Etymology: < classical Latin Ōgygius of or relating to Ogyges, Theban, ancient ( < ancient Greek Ὠγύγιος < Ὤγυγος, Ὠγύγης, the name of Ogyges, a legendary king of Thebes, in Boeotia + -ιος, suffix forming adjectives) + -an suffix.It is possible that the personal name Ὤγυγος , Ὠγύγης may represent a back-formation from the adjective, invented by the ancient grammarians. The adjective is of unknown origin and its precise sense is unclear, but it appears to indicate extreme antiquity. It is unclear whether the following example represents this adjective or Ogygian adj.2, or with which precise connotations:1885 G. Meredith Diana of Crossways I. i. 25 The comic of it, the adventurous, the tragic, they make devilish, to kindle their Ogygian hilarity.
Of, associated with, or relating to the mythical Attic or Boeotian king Ogyges or his realm. Also (in extended use): of great age (rare).A great flood was supposed to have occurred during Ogyges' reign.

1567 G. Turberville tr. Ovid Heroycall Epist. x. 61v I with tresses then depending sole did runne, Incited by the Ogigian God [L. Ogygio..deo] as doth the drowsie Nunne.
1614 A. Gorges tr. Lucan Pharsalia i. 40 As Ogigian wine [L. Ogygio..Lyaeo] distraines The madding humor of her braines: So did a Matron of the Towne In franticke wise gadde vp and downe.
1693 Philos. Trans. (Royal Soc.) 17 810 Then he mentions the Ogygian and Deucaleon Floods.
1843 R. H. Horne Orion i. iii. 148 He..wished the Ogygian deluge were returned.
1858 T. J. Hogg Life Shelley I. iv. 139 Sir Bysshe being Ogygian, gouty, and bedridden.
1916 J. G. Frazer in Jrnl. Royal Anthropol. Inst. Great Brit. & Ireland 46 271 The connexion of Ogyges with Bœotia in general and Thebes in particular is further vouched for by the name Ogygian which was bestowed on the land, on the city, and on one of its gates.

Ogygianadj.2

Brit. /əʊˈdʒɪdʒɪən/, U.S. /oʊˈdʒɪdʒiən/
Forms: 1500s Ogygean, 1700s– Ogygian.
Origin: From proper names, combined with an English element. Etymons: proper name Ōgygia , Ὠγυγία , -an suffix.
Etymology: < classical Latin Ōgygia, ancient Greek Ὠγυγία, the name of the island in Homer where Calypso lived + -an suffix.
Of or relating to the mythological island of Ogygia in Homer's Odyssey where Calypso lived.

1596 P. Colse Penelopes Complaint l. 932 Nor yet Calypso with her skill, When in Ogygean Isle I staid, Could with her druggs win my good will.
1725 C. Pitt tr. M. G. Vida Art Poetry ii. 45 But set him down, (his dear companions lost,) With fair Calypso on the Ogygian coast.
1892 Cent. Mag. Sept. 688/2 The magical dwelling of the enchantress Calypso finds no parallel in these Antillean seas, nor can the Ogygian growths compare with this harvest of strange products.
1979 Yale French Stud. 57 170 In Homer his [sc. Télémaque's] quest is a sub-plot which evolves within the parentheses of Ulysses' Ogygian sojourn.
